What is the opinion on when to start and tempt your puppies with water and the idea of drinking independantly, a friend has asked I tend to tempt them with water when I start weaning around 4 weeks or sometimes a little earlier if the puppies seem quite forward at around 3 and a half weeks.
- By JeanSW Date 18.04.10 09:54 UTC
My pups have access to fresh water as soon as they can stand.
- By white lilly [gb] Date 18.04.10 12:08 UTC
same here , i have water there for them as soon as here on the move ,i dont give milk to drink they get that from mum ,but do start to wean mine at 2 weeks and 3days old large greedy breed lol.
- By Goldmali Date 18.04.10 17:43 UTC
I never try to get mine interested in water, it's just there for when they want it.
